Margaret Court Arena: Amanda Anisimova and Lorenzo Musetti secured wins in their respective third-round games at the Australian Open against Peyton Stearns and Tomas Machac. While the former played at the Margaret Court Arena, the latter competed at the John Cain Arena on Day 7 of the first Grand Slam of the season.
Anisimova secured her place in the Australian Open fourth round for the second year in a row, defeating American compatriot Peyton Stearns 6-1, 6-4 in just one hour and 11 minutes. The World No. 4 came out strong, saving a break point in the opening game before breaking Stearns twice to race to a 5-1 lead in the first set. She comfortably served out the set in just over 30 minutes, showing little sign of trouble.
In the second set, Anisimova was in control at 5-2, but Stearns mounted a late comeback. The former University of Texas player fought off a match point and broke back to close the gap to 5-4. Despite the momentum shift, Anisimova remained focused and clinched the win with a forehand winner on her third match point.
